Abstract
Science is at its best when shared widely both within the scientific community and to the broader public. To maintain trust in science while simultaneously maximizing openness, it is important that every paper is carefully vetted. For this we rely on many volunteers, especially our peer reviewers. Their work is key for maintaining the integrity of scientific journals and to ensure the highest standards of scientific rigor. Reviewers verify that the assumptions, the methods, and the inferences made in our papers are sound. Many spend hours going over derivations, analyses, and evaluating the novelty and significance of the submitted manuscript. In 2019,JGR Planetsbenefited from 901 reviews provided by 584 unique reviewers. On behalf of the entire editorial board ofJGR Planetsand the entire planetary science community, we want to express here our most heartfelt gratitude to all of you. Thank you!Plain Language Summary
